Abstract Class UML 2.3::StructuredClassifier

Description:

A structured classifier is an abstract metaclass that represents any classifier whose behavior can be fully or partly described by the collaboration of owned or referenced instances.

Direct Superclasses: Classifier

Direct Subclasses: EncapsulatedClassifier, Collaboration

Class Precedence List: StructuredClassifier, Classifier, TemplateableElement, Type, PackageableElement, ParameterableElement, Namespace, RedefinableElement, NamedElement, Element
